Traditional Methods vs. Agile Approach
Traditional methods often rely on rigid structures and sequential phases. These approaches follow a strict timeline, making changes difficult once the project has begun. This can lead to delays when unexpected challenges arise.
In contrast, the agile approach emphasizes flexibility and adaptability. Teams work in short cycles or sprints, allowing for regular reassessment of goals and priorities. Feedback is integrated continuously, enabling quick responses to user needs.
Collaboration is at the heart of agility. Cross-functional teams break down silos present in traditional models. This fosters innovation as ideas flow freely between members from different expertise areas.
While traditional frameworks might seem more predictable, they can stifle creativity and responsiveness. The agile approach encourages experimentation and learning through iteration an essential factor in today’s fast-paced environment where change is constant.
Choosing between these two methodologies depends on specific project requirements but understanding their core differences helps organizations make informed decisions about their development strategies.

3-Axis vs. 5-Axis CNC Machines: Which Do You Need?
CNC machining has revolutionized manufacturing with unmatched precision and repeatability, crucial for industries like automotive and electronics. For shop owners and procurement managers, the challenge lies in choosing between 3-axis and 5-axis machines. While it may seem that 5-axis machines outperform due to their complexity, the decision depends on factors like budget, part complexity, and production volume.
The Basics of 3-Axis CNC Machines
3-axis machining is the most widely used technique in mechanical engineering and manufacturing. It has been the industry standard for decades due to its relative simplicity and reliability.
How it Works
As the name suggests, these machines operate along three linear axes:
- X-Axis: Moves the cutting tool left to right.
- Y-Axis: Moves the cutting tool front to back.
- Z-Axis: Moves the cutting tool up and down.
In a standard setup, the workpiece remains stationary on the machine bed while the cutting tool moves along these three planes to remove material. The tool is always perpendicular to the material surface. While vertical machining centers are the most recognizable form of this technology, this category also includes horizontal milling centers which use gravity to help clear chips away from the workpiece.
Advantages and Limitations
The primary advantage of 3-axis machining is cost-efficiency. These machines are generally less expensive to purchase and easier to program than their multi-axis counterparts. For simple operations like drilling holes, cutting sharp edges, or milling slots, a 3-axis machine is fast and accurate.
However, the limitation lies in geometry. Because the tool can only approach the workpiece from one direction (top-down), you cannot machine undercuts or complex angles without stopping the machine and manually repositioning the part. This manual intervention increases setup time and introduces the potential for human error, which can affect the final tolerance of the part.
Introduction to 5-Axis CNC Machines
If 3-axis machines are the reliable workhorses of the industry, 5-axis machines are the high-performance specialists. They take the standard X, Y, and Z movements and introduce rotational capabilities.
Understanding the Extra Axes
To achieve 5-axis movement, the machine utilizes the standard linear axes but adds two rotational axes, typically labeled as:
- A-Axis: Rotation around the X-axis.
- B-Axis: Rotation around the Y-axis.
Depending on the specific machine configuration, either the cutting head tilts and rotates, or the table holding the workpiece (the trunnion) moves. This allows the cutting tool to approach the part from virtually any angle.
Enhanced Capabilities
The defining feature of 5-axis machining is the ability to machine complex shapes that would be impossible or incredibly time-consuming on a 3-axis machine. The tool can maintain optimal contact with the material surface, swiveling to follow curved geometries smoothly. This capability is essential for creating organic shapes, impellers, and parts with intricate architectural features.
Key Differences Between 3-Axis and 5-Axis Systems
Comparing these two technologies requires looking beyond just the hardware. The differences impact your entire workflow, from the design phase to the final inspection.
Setup and Efficiency
This is often the deciding factor for many shops. On a 3-axis machine, if you need to work on all sides of a block, you must manually flip the part and re-fixture it for every new face. This is known as multiple setups.
A 5-axis machine facilitates “Done-in-One” or single-setup machining. You can secure the part once, and the machine can rotate to access five of the six sides of a prismatic part. This drastically reduces total production time and eliminates the accumulation of alignment errors that occur every time a human operator moves the part.
Complexity and Precision
5-axis machines offer superior precision for complex geometries. Because the cutting head can tilt, it can use shorter, sturdier cutting tools. Shorter tools vibrate less and deflect less, resulting in a smoother surface finish and higher accuracy. 3-axis machines often require longer tools to reach deep cavities, which can lead to chatter and a rougher finish.
Programming and Operation
The operational barrier to entry is higher with 5-axis technology. Generating the toolpaths requires advanced CAD/CAM software and a skilled programmer who understands how to prevent the tool holder from colliding with the workpiece or the table. 3-axis programming is significantly more straightforward, making it easier to find qualified operators.
Cost Considerations
There is a stark price difference. 5-axis machines can cost significantly more than 3-axis centers. Beyond the initial capital investment, the maintenance costs, tooling, and software licenses are also higher. However, for the right application, the speed and reduced labor costs of a 5-axis machine can result in a higher return on investment over time.
Applications Best Suited for Each Machine
Selecting the right machine is usually a matter of matching the tool to the product.
When to Use 3-Axis
A 3-axis machine is the ideal choice for parts with relatively simple geometries. It excels at:
- Planar milling and drilling.
- Parts where all features are accessible from a single side.
- High-volume production of simple components.
- Projects with tight budget constraints where the speed of a 5-axis setup isn’t necessary.
Typical industries include general manufacturing, automotive brackets, and cabinetry.
When to Use 5-Axis
You should consider moving to 5-axis machining when:
- The part has complex, contoured surfaces (like a turbine blade).
- The part requires machining on multiple faces and tight tolerances are critical.
- You need to drill holes at compound angles.
- You are producing high-value, low-volume parts where setup time is a major cost driver.
This technology is standard in the aerospace industry (for airfoils), medical manufacturing (for hip replacements and prosthetics), and high-end automotive prototyping.
Factors to Consider When Choosing
Before signing a purchase order, evaluate your specific operational needs against the following criteria.
Part Complexity
Look at your current and projected order book. Are you turning away work because you can’t handle the geometry? If your parts are mostly flat with simple holes, a 5-axis machine is likely overkill. If you are constantly designing fixtures to hold parts at weird angles for a 3-axis mill, a 5-axis machine could solve your bottlenecks.
Production Volume and Mix
For “High Mix, Low Volume” production—where you make small batches of many different complex parts—the 5-axis is superior because it minimizes setup time. For “Low Mix, High Volume” production of simple parts, a fleet of affordable 3-axis machines might offer better throughput than a single expensive 5-axis unit.
Budget and ROI
Do not just look at the sticker price. Calculate the cost per part. If a 5-axis machine cuts your labor time in half by eliminating setups, it may pay for itself faster than a cheaper 3-axis machine that requires constant operator attention. Conversely, if the machine sits idle because you don’t have enough complex work to justify it, it becomes a financial drain.
